StringCollection.IList.IndexOf(Object)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Recherche le Object spécifié et retourne l’index de base zéro de la première occurrence dans l’ensemble du StringCollection.
virtual int System.Collections.IList.IndexOf(System::Object ^ value) = System::Collections::IList::IndexOf;
int IList.IndexOf (object value);
int IList.IndexOf (object? value);
abstract member System.Collections.IList.IndexOf : obj -> int
override this.System.Collections.IList.IndexOf : obj -> int
Function IndexOf (value As Object) As Integer Implements IList.IndexOf
Paramètres
- value
- Object
Object à rechercher dans StringCollection. La valeur peut être null
.
Retours
Index de base zéro de la première occurrence de value
dans l'ensemble du StringCollection, s'il existe ; sinon, -1.
Implémente
Remarques
Est StringCollection recherché vers l’avant en commençant au premier élément et se terminant par le dernier élément.
Cette méthode détermine l’égalité en appelant Object.Equals.
Cette méthode effectue une recherche linéaire ; par conséquent, cette méthode est une opération O(n
), où n
est Count.
À compter de .NET Framework 2.0, cette méthode utilise les objets et CompareTo les Equals méthodes item
de la collection pour déterminer si l’élément existe. Dans les versions antérieures du .NET Framework, cette détermination a été effectuée à l’aide Equals des méthodes et CompareTo du item
paramètre sur les objets de la collection.